推荐系统之大数据技术(超全面)

Hadoop(HDFS文件系统)

推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Hive推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Kafka

推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Flume

1.1Flume定义

Flume是Cloudera提供的一个高可用的,高可靠的,分布式的海量日志采集、聚合和传输的系统。Flume基于流式架构,灵活简单。

推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

推荐系统之大数据技术(超全面)
Flume 自带两种Channel:Memory Channel和File Channel。
Memory Channel是内存中的队列。Memory Channel在不需要关心数据丢失的情景下适用。如果需要关心数据丢失,那么Memory Channel就不应该使用,因为程序死亡、机器右机或者重启都会导致数据丢失。
File Channel将所有事件写到磁盘。因此在程序关闭或机器宕机的情况下不会丢失数据。
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Azkaban

1.1什么是Azkaban

Azkaban是由Linkedin公司推出的一个批量工作流任务调度器,主要用于在一个工作流内以一个特定的顺序运行一组工作和流程,它的配置是通过简单的key:value对的方式,通过配置中的Dependencies 来设置依赖关系。Azkaban使用job配置文件建立任务之间的依赖关系,并提供一个易于使用的web用户界面维护和跟踪你的工作流。推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Sqoop推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Hbase

推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)
推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)

Zookeeper

推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)推荐系统之大数据技术(超全面)